3. Data Pipeline & Storage
User vectors and contextual knowledge are stored in a highly scalable PostgreSQL cluster with pgvector. All sensitive telemetry and token monitoring data flows through dedicated encrypted pipelines to provide real-time metrics for executive agents. The integration of Prisma ORM ensures strongly typed database queries, while raw SQL is reserved strictly for complex geospatial or high-dimensional vector similarity searches (using exact nearest neighbor or HNSW indexing depending on latency requirements).
